The Butleigh game being off meant 15 lads could play on Thursday at Holyrood instead of just 8 at Butleigh - that must be good for our lads.
Nathan and Bobby were Captains and selected these players:-
Nathan Johnson + Niall Crouch + Samuel Ogbonna + Ehren Anderson + Luke Young + James Driscoll
Bobby Lord + Daniel Miller + Matthew Haines + Taylor Symes + Owen Ladd + Ben Molesworth + Charlie Sparks
On winning the toss Bobby decided to field first so Luke and James opened as James played carefully in getting 3 singles while Luke was more aggressive in making 11 runs which could have been many more but for some excellent fielding, in particular from Owen and Daniel, who both stopped the ball from reaching the boundary off some hard hit shots by Luke it has to be said.
Their partnership was worth 24 runs although each was out once - Daniel bowled James while Luke was run out but other than that mix up they ran very well together - setting the tone for the evening as far as running between the wickets was concerned.
Next pair in was Samuel and Niall and it was not surprising to see Niall being the positive partner while Samuel was more restrained as he hit 5 runs in contrast to Niall's 23 which included 3 hard hit boundary fours as well as 3 very well run twos.
Neither was out as their partnership was worth 34 runs from their 4 overs at the crease - excellent batting you two - partnerships need both players doing what they are good at and it certainly showed with these two as they put on 32 runs together.
Nathan and Ehren were the last pair to bat and neither found it easy as the bowling did become a little wayward but Nathan hit one super boundary in his 9 runs and Ehren did better the longer he batted and finished with 6 runs to his name.
Both were out once but their 4 over partnership was worth 24 runs to take the team score to 82 runs scored with 4 wickets lost - giving a 'nett' score of 50.
The bowling was generally quite good with Daniel and Owen each taking a wicket for very few runs while Matthew bowled one wide but otherwise bowled very straight indeed.
As mentioned the best fielding undoubtedly came from Owen and Daniel who both made excellent stops from hard hit balls.
Could Bobby's team beat that first innings score ?
Daniel and Charlie opened and Daniel was soon out caught behind by Nathan off Samuel's excellent bowling and then he was run out as just 14 runs were scored in the first 4 overs. Each batter hit 5 runs and that was against some very tight bowling by Samuel and Niall - Charlie managed to bat his overs without getting out - that was an achievement in itself so well done Charlie.
Matthew then hit 5 runs while Taylor was restricted to just 2 runs in their partnership of 15 runs but they batted against Luke who bowled very well indeed as he took one wicket while only being hit for one run plus a wide in his 2 over spell.
At the other end James probably bowled as well as he has ever done in having just 12 runs knocked of his 2 overs with the 2nd over having no wides in it at all.
With just 6 overs of the match left Bobby's team were some 55 runs adrift of the total to beat - but their two best batters were now at the crease.
Bobby hits the ball hard, even harder than Niall would you believe, and he struck a boundary 4 and two huge 6s off his first four balls - but - then he was brilliantly caught by Samuel off another big hit.
Great catch Samuel - only you and Niall would have caught that catch as it was a very steep and difficult catch to take - terrific stuff.
Owen also showed he can hit the ball when he wants to he left behind his nervous 'I don't want to attack it in case I get out' thoughts as he struck 4 boundary fours in his knock of 17 runs but it was Bobby who again hit four boundary 4s plus those two 6s in his toal of 31 as the pair put on 51 runs in their 4 overs but lost 2 wickets in the process.
With 2 extra overs being bowled so that our newest U11/12 player Ben could have a bat - he was rather reluctant it has to be said as this was the very first time he had played hard-ball cricket - but Ben did very well to first face the spin of Niall and then the speed of our quickest bowler Samuel.
With Owen to assist him Ben did very well indeed as he was not out at the end having scored 4 runs - so well done Ben - you did much better than you thought you would do is my guess.
This last partnership took the total to 88 runs scored but having lost 6 wickets - each wicket in U12 cricket costs 8 runs remember then 48 runs had to be deducted from those 88 scored - which meant their 'nett' score was 40.
So 50 beats 40 does it not ? But in reality off the same number of overs Nathan's team hit 82 runs while Bobby's team hit 88 runs - so when you start playing 'proper' cricket from U13 onwards when it is the team which scores the more runs that wins and not the team who loses less wickets in the game - then this aggression will start paying dividends for sure.
So please do still play your shots but just keep the ball on the ground more so that you do not give your wickets away with shots resulting in catches - even if those catches are very good indeed - like Samuel's was this evening.
